  1. Go for Regal Layering with a Choga

If you want to add depth and drama to your winter wedding attire, consider incorporating a choga into your ensemble. A choga is an open, robe-like garment that can be layered over a kurta set for added grandeur. Torani's Dil Shaad Bahman Choga Set is one such example of men's designer clothes that says how you can use layering to create a royal effect. Crafted in luxurious jeni silk and muslin, this set includes a choga, kurta, and pants in a balanced combination of black hues and digital prints.

Layering with a choga not only gives you warmth for those winter weddings but also that touch of royalty and elegance to your overall attire.
